>> We'd be using Cython if it were not for a few pesky bugs we've yet  
>> to work around, namely our source is arranged in a manner which  
>> Cython cannot handle;
>>
>> src/<extension>/soy.<extension>.pyx which includes src/<extension>/ 
>> <EachClass>.pxi
>>
>> The resulting compile, as you could likely guess, raises errors  
>> such as:
>>   AttributeError: 'src.colors.soy.colors.Color' object has no  
>> attribute '_a'
> 
> 
> Yes, we handle submodule naming based on the directory hierarchy to  
> be consistent with Python. Sorry this doesn't work for you.

Like you, Arc, I would prefer that I could use one
set of file names that would work for both Pyrex and Cython.
I ended up creating a Makefile that can switch between
cython and pyrex and a small helper script to link the pyx
and pxd files under both naming conventions.

The Makefile passes into setup.py a parameter to tell it
which names and paths to use depending on the compiler.
Yes, it is a hack but it allows me to switch back and forth
for testing.  (The Makefile runs "python setup.py usecython"
from the parent directory to make this all work).
